At The Drive-In lead Benicassim announcement

The Benicassim Festival booking is the first European festival the post-hardcore luminaries have confirmed since announcing their reformation.
Supporting the recently released new album ‘Given To The Wild’, The Maccabees have also joined the bill, along with Dave Clarke, Bat For Lashes,
Little Dragon and Yuksek.
SebastiAn, Delorentos, Lisa Hannigan,
Arp Attack, Sons Phonetic and Ham Sandwich are also set to perform, as
are Pony Bravo, Klaus & Kinski, The Secret Society and Juanita
y los Feos.
They join the previously-announced likes of The Stone Roses, New
Order, Noel Gallagher’s High Flying Birds, Florence & The Machine, David
Guetta, Dizzee Rascal, Bombay Bicycle Club and The Horrors at
the event.
Dizzee Rascal, Crystal Castles, Example, Katy B,
Miles Kane, Maverick Sabre, The Vaccines, Kurt Vile & The Violators,
Thee Brandy Hips and VF Ones To Watch Howler will also be at the festival, which runs from
12-15 July in Benicassim, Spain.
